A Steam card typically has the Steam logo and the amount imprinted on it, with a 15-alphanumeric code and the trademark of the Steam company on it, and may also have the retail store from where the card was purchased and “United States” written boldly on it. The card’s design and features can vary depending on the region and denomination, but it usually resembles a standard gift card with the Steam branding and a unique code to redeem the card’s value on the Steam platform.

FAQ 1: How does a Steam gift card work?

A Steam gift card works just like a gift certificate, which can be redeemed on Steam for the purchase of games, software, and any other item available on the platform.

FAQ 2: Why is someone asking me to buy a Steam card?

If someone contacts you to pay them in Steam Wallet Gift Cards, you are most likely targeted in a scam, as Steam does not require gift cards for any transactions between users.

FAQ 3: Can a Steam card be converted to cash?

No, Wallet funds cannot be moved or withdrawn to a bank account, and once a Steam Wallet code has been redeemed on an account, the wallet funds are tied to that account.

FAQ 4: What happens if you accept a Steam gift?

Once you click Accept Gift, the game will be added directly to your Library, and if you click on Decline Gift, a refund will be issued to the original sender.

FAQ 5: What does buying a Steam gift mean?

When you purchase a game on Steam, you can choose to gift the item to anyone on your Steam friends list, and the recipient will receive the gift as an attractive e-mail card with a personal message and instructions to redeem the game.

FAQ 6: Do I have to buy a Steam card to receive money?

Absolutely not, as this is a scam, and PayPal does not require you to buy a gift card and provide the card’s access code in order to receive your money.

FAQ 7: Do stores still sell Steam cards?

Yes, Steam Gift Cards and Wallet Codes can be found at retail stores across the world in a variety of denominations.

FAQ 8: What is a $100 Steam card used for?

A $100 Steam card can be used to purchase anything available on the Steam platform, including games, software, DLC content, and in-game items.

FAQ 9: What country uses Steam cards?

Steam gift cards can be bought and redeemed in over 150 countries across the world, including the United States, Mexico, Canada, Belgium, Germany, France, the United Kingdom, Australia, and Switzerland.

FAQ 10: What can you do with a $50 Steam card?

A $50 Steam card works just like a gift certificate, and can be redeemed on Steam for the purchase of games, software, wallet credit, and any other item available on Steam.

FAQ 11: How much money can you put on a Steam card?

The minimum and maximum limits for Steam gift cards are $5 and $2000, respectively.

FAQ 12: How long does a $50 Steam card last?

Gift cards for Steam Wallet never expire, and digital cards are available in values of $5, $10, $25, $50, and $100.
